Freelancing with a Mobile Phone
Freelancing with a mobile phone means working independently for a company, brand, or individual and receiving payment based on the work completed. In this, you are not an employee under anyone, but rather you choose projects according to your time and convenience. Today, the demand for video content is rapidly increasing on platforms like Instagram, YouTube, and Facebook. As a result, the demand for individuals who can edit videos and reels on their mobile phones is continually increasing.

Reel and Video Editing
Today, small shopkeepers, local businesses, YouTubers, and social media creators want their videos to look attractive and professional. Good editing helps videos reach more people and increases views. In this situation, the role of a mobile editor becomes extremely important. You can do tasks like cutting videos, adding music, adding text, and adding transitions. You can earn 300 to 1000 rupees for editing one reel. If you work for a few clients every day, your monthly income can easily reach 30,000 rupees.

Video Editing on Mobile
Today, there are many apps available for editing on mobile phones that are easy to learn and offer good features for free. CapCut is currently the most popular app, offering ready-made templates and effects. VN Video Editor provides the facility to create clean videos without watermarks. InShot is considered particularly useful for Instagram Reels and short videos. KineMaster is a bit advanced, but it allows for professional-quality editing. Initially, it’s enough to get a good grasp of one or two apps.

How to start learning video editing
If you’ve never done video editing before, there’s no need to worry. Thousands of free tutorials are available on YouTube in Hindi, explaining the entire mobile editing process. Dedicate a little time each day to practice and create some reels and videos of your own. Gradually, when you have 10 to 15 good samples ready, they will serve as your portfolio and can be shown to clients.

Where and how to find freelance work
There are many easy ways to find work in mobile freelancing. Social media is the biggest platform in this regard. New job postings appear daily in video editing and freelancing groups on Facebook. You can directly message small creators and local businesses on Instagram to offer your services. Besides this, you can also create an account on freelance websites like Fiverr and Upwork using your mobile phone and find work there. Keeping your rates a little lower initially increases the chances of getting your first client.
